Author: bentmann Date: Sat Jun 6 12:37:34 2009 New Revision: 782243 URL: http://svn.apache.org/viewvc?rev=782243&view=rev Log: o Improved propagation of parse errors
Modified: maven/components/trunk/maven-core/src/main/java/org/apache/maven/project/RepositoryModelResolver.java maven/components/trunk/maven-model-builder/src/main/java/org/apache/maven/model/DefaultModelBuilder.java Modified: maven/components/trunk/maven-core/src/main/java/org/apache/maven/project/RepositoryModelResolver.java URL: http://svn.apache.org/viewvc/maven/components/trunk/maven-core/src/main/java/org/apache/maven/project/RepositoryModelResolver.java?rev=782243&r1=782242&r2=782243&view=diff ============================================================================== --- maven/components/trunk/maven-core/src/main/java/org/apache/maven/project/RepositoryModelResolver.java (original) +++ maven/components/trunk/maven-core/src/main/java/org/apache/maven/project/RepositoryModelResolver.java Sat Jun 6 12:37:34 2009 @@ -23,7 +23,6 @@ import java.util.Arrays; import java.util.Iterator; import java.util.List; -import java.util.Map; import org.apache.maven.artifact.Artifact; import org.apache.maven.artifact.repository.ArtifactRepository; Modified: maven/components/trunk/maven-model-builder/src/main/java/org/apache/maven/model/DefaultModelBuilder.java URL: http://svn.apache.org/viewvc/maven/components/trunk/maven-model-builder/src/main/java/org/apache/maven/model/DefaultModelBuilder.java?rev=782243&r1=782242&r2=782243&view=diff ============================================================================== --- maven/components/trunk/maven-model-builder/src/main/java/org/apache/maven/model/DefaultModelBuilder.java (original) +++ maven/components/trunk/maven-model-builder/src/main/java/org/apache/maven/model/DefaultModelBuilder.java Sat Jun 6 12:37:34 2009 @@ -207,8 +207,8 @@ } catch ( ModelParseException e ) { - throw new UnparseableModelException( "Failed to parse POM " + modelSource.getLocation(), e.getLineNumber(), - e.getColumnNumber(), e ); + throw new UnparseableModelException( "Failed to parse POM " + modelSource.getLocation() + ": " + + e.getMessage(), e.getLineNumber(), e.getColumnNumber(), e ); } catch ( IOException e ) {